WebIf we can meta-learn a faster reinforcement learner, we can learn new tasks efficiently! What can a meta-learned learner do differently? 1.Explore more intelligently, 2.Avoid trying actions that are know to be useless, 3.Acquire the right features more quickly. Web16 dec. 2024 · Meta-Learning The word “meta” usually indicates something more comprehensive or more abstract. For example, a metaverse is a virtual world or the world inside our world, metadata is data that provides information about other data and similarly. Likewise, in this case, meta-learning refers to learning about learning.
